
WYŁĄCZNIE pomysły na poprawę działania i funkcjnalność softu
-
- Lider FORUM (min. 2000)
- Posty w temacie: 15
- Posty: 3730
- Rejestracja: 13 gru 2008, 19:32
- Lokalizacja: Szczecin
- Kontakt:
Taka idea.
Mam do zrobienia 10 CAMów dla dziesięcu cyfr 0-9 (mam je zapisane w dxf).
Dla każdego wpisuję identyczne parametry obróbki.
1. Pomysł nr1
Po zastosowaniu jakiegoś zestawu parametrów powinien on być zachowany gdzieś w pliku konfiguracyjnym tak, żeby otworzenie kolejnego pliku do generowania CAM i wybór konkretnego typu obróbki ('wybieranie') automatycznie wpisywał ostatnio użyte parametry.
2. Pomysł nr2
Po zastosowaniu jakiegoś zestawu parametrów chciałbym mieć guzik 'kopiuj zestaw parametrów', po to, że jak otwieram inny element, który ma być tak samo obrabiany - mógł kliknąć 'wklej zestaw parametrów' i nie martwić się, że nie przeoczyłem zmiany prędkości wrzeciona z 2000 na 20000.
Różni się tylko o zero a frezy padają jak muchy
3. Pomysł nr3
W przyborniku 'Narzędzia' chciałbym podawać domyślną prędkość wrzeciona dla konkretnego frezu.
W CAM po wybraniu konkretnego frezu ustawia mi się z automata domyślna prędkość wrzeciona, którą mogę sobie ręcznie zmienić (tak jak dotychczas). Każda zmiana narzędzia w CAM powoduje automatyczne wczytanie domyślnej prędkości wrzeciona.
4. Pomysł nr4
Wpisując kolejne pozycje w CAM chciałbym żeby kliknięcie na jednym wpisanym polu z wartością zostawiało tą wartość i przechodziło do kolejnego pola z wartością w trybie do edycji.
Coś jak w programach do fakturowania w DOS, gdzie klawisz Enter jest najczęściej klepanym klawiszem używanym do przejścia z pola edycyjnego na kolejne pole.
Teraz to się zatrzymuje m.in. na paskach z nazwami kolejnych "sekcji" parametrów.
Od biedy można zrobić, że pacnięcie enter na nazwie takiego działu przechodzi na kolejne pole edycyjne parametru.
W sekcji 'Głębokość' na pasku informacyjnym 'Przejść/Krok' w sekcji 'Narzędź' na 'Info'.
To by znacząco uszybciło prędkość generowania g-code'u, zwiększyło wydajność programistów, większe przychody dla firmy, więcej kupowanych maszyn przezbrajanych na Piko
Mam do zrobienia 10 CAMów dla dziesięcu cyfr 0-9 (mam je zapisane w dxf).
Dla każdego wpisuję identyczne parametry obróbki.
1. Pomysł nr1
Po zastosowaniu jakiegoś zestawu parametrów powinien on być zachowany gdzieś w pliku konfiguracyjnym tak, żeby otworzenie kolejnego pliku do generowania CAM i wybór konkretnego typu obróbki ('wybieranie') automatycznie wpisywał ostatnio użyte parametry.
2. Pomysł nr2
Po zastosowaniu jakiegoś zestawu parametrów chciałbym mieć guzik 'kopiuj zestaw parametrów', po to, że jak otwieram inny element, który ma być tak samo obrabiany - mógł kliknąć 'wklej zestaw parametrów' i nie martwić się, że nie przeoczyłem zmiany prędkości wrzeciona z 2000 na 20000.
Różni się tylko o zero a frezy padają jak muchy

3. Pomysł nr3
W przyborniku 'Narzędzia' chciałbym podawać domyślną prędkość wrzeciona dla konkretnego frezu.
W CAM po wybraniu konkretnego frezu ustawia mi się z automata domyślna prędkość wrzeciona, którą mogę sobie ręcznie zmienić (tak jak dotychczas). Każda zmiana narzędzia w CAM powoduje automatyczne wczytanie domyślnej prędkości wrzeciona.
4. Pomysł nr4
Wpisując kolejne pozycje w CAM chciałbym żeby kliknięcie na jednym wpisanym polu z wartością zostawiało tą wartość i przechodziło do kolejnego pola z wartością w trybie do edycji.
Coś jak w programach do fakturowania w DOS, gdzie klawisz Enter jest najczęściej klepanym klawiszem używanym do przejścia z pola edycyjnego na kolejne pole.
Teraz to się zatrzymuje m.in. na paskach z nazwami kolejnych "sekcji" parametrów.
Od biedy można zrobić, że pacnięcie enter na nazwie takiego działu przechodzi na kolejne pole edycyjne parametru.
W sekcji 'Głębokość' na pasku informacyjnym 'Przejść/Krok' w sekcji 'Narzędź' na 'Info'.
To by znacząco uszybciło prędkość generowania g-code'u, zwiększyło wydajność programistów, większe przychody dla firmy, więcej kupowanych maszyn przezbrajanych na Piko

-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 63
- Posty: 2920
- Rejestracja: 27 maja 2013, 22:18
- Lokalizacja: gdzieś
Dobry pomysł z tym, żeby dla różnych frezów były domniemane parametry obróbki definiowalne dla różnych materiałów. Ale nie wiem czy to się da sensownie zrobić. Po pierwsze musiałoby być dużo więcej miejsc na narzędzia w zasobniku. Bo geometria śladu + średnica nie byłaby już jedynym wyznacznikiem. W tej chwili wstukuje np "walcowy 2,5mm" a tak musiałbym mieć oddzielnie 3 rodzaje pilników + 5 rodzajów spiralnych, wszystkie walcowe 2,5mm. Po drugie musiałby być jakiś bogaty rekord na rodzaje materiału. Nawet aluminium jedno drugiemu nie równe a co dopiero różne tworzywa na przykład.
Tylko czy to by nie utrudniło pracy zamiast przyspieszyć? Wybranie parametrów dla niewłaściwego narzędzie tez mogłoby się zakończyć usterką.
P.S. Identyczne parametry obróbki można zapisać na dysk jako domyślne.
Tylko czy to by nie utrudniło pracy zamiast przyspieszyć? Wybranie parametrów dla niewłaściwego narzędzie tez mogłoby się zakończyć usterką.
P.S. Identyczne parametry obróbki można zapisać na dysk jako domyślne.
-
- Lider FORUM (min. 2000)
- Posty w temacie: 15
- Posty: 3730
- Rejestracja: 13 gru 2008, 19:32
- Lokalizacja: Szczecin
- Kontakt:
MC Kwacz - no ale już bez takiej papierologii - nawet tylko jedna domyślna prędkość byłaby OK.
RobWan - A to 2.2.1 to już jest przestarzałe? Oj. Zaraz sprawdzę.
O u mnie działa
Nie wiedziałem jak się do tego doklikać - szukałem ordynarnego przycisku. Dzięks za pomoc.
I kolejna sprawa.
Robię generator, zapisałem sobie pliczki .nc na konkretne cyfry i będę je sklejał w ciągi o kolejne cyfry translował/przesuwał w X o szerokość poprzednej cyfry + 1.5mm itp.
Mając programy na frezowanie 100, 101, 102 ... chciałbym je wrzucić do jednego pliku .nc i podzielić jakimś kodem jak M00.
Czyli:
frezuję pierwszą część kodu ('100')
M00 - wrzeciono odjeżdża 150mm w górę.
Zmieniam detal.
Klikam 'Start'
Piko frezuje kolejną część kodu ('101')
M00 - wrzeciono odjeżda 150mm w górę.
Zmieniam detal.
Klikam 'Start'.
....
i tak 300 razy ...
W Piko M00 zatrzymuje pracę do kolejnego kliknięcia start i rozpoczyna pracę od kolejnego kodu?
{EDIT}
Doczytałem w manualu, że M0 to
Program stop. Program zostanie zatrzymany w ten spowób jakby naciśnięto "Pauzę". Po ponownym naciśnięciu Pauzy program jest wznawiany.
Mogę dalej generować
RobWan - A to 2.2.1 to już jest przestarzałe? Oj. Zaraz sprawdzę.
O u mnie działa

I kolejna sprawa.
Robię generator, zapisałem sobie pliczki .nc na konkretne cyfry i będę je sklejał w ciągi o kolejne cyfry translował/przesuwał w X o szerokość poprzednej cyfry + 1.5mm itp.
Mając programy na frezowanie 100, 101, 102 ... chciałbym je wrzucić do jednego pliku .nc i podzielić jakimś kodem jak M00.
Czyli:
frezuję pierwszą część kodu ('100')
M00 - wrzeciono odjeżdża 150mm w górę.
Zmieniam detal.
Klikam 'Start'
Piko frezuje kolejną część kodu ('101')
M00 - wrzeciono odjeżda 150mm w górę.
Zmieniam detal.
Klikam 'Start'.
....
i tak 300 razy ...

W Piko M00 zatrzymuje pracę do kolejnego kliknięcia start i rozpoczyna pracę od kolejnego kodu?
{EDIT}
Doczytałem w manualu, że M0 to
Program stop. Program zostanie zatrzymany w ten spowób jakby naciśnięto "Pauzę". Po ponownym naciśnięciu Pauzy program jest wznawiany.
Mogę dalej generować

-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 63
- Posty: 2920
- Rejestracja: 27 maja 2013, 22:18
- Lokalizacja: gdzieś
Kto wie do czego służy szablon ze zrzutu ekranowego 2 posty wcześniej i czym to się je?
2.2.2
Nie wiem czy to błąd czy raczej celowe. Miałem taką potrzebę, żeby jeden z elementów rysunku (okrąg) delikatnie przeskalować bez modyfikacji źródła rysunku (bo już miałem wszystkie elementy w camie pracowicie przygotowane). Element był w wydzielonej grupie wraz z innym koncentrycznym do niego okręgiem. Po przeskalowaniu środek figury uległ przesunięciu, bo zdaje się że lewy dolny róg figury jest traktowany jako środek układu współrzędnych. No i potem musiałem to "na oko" ręcznie centrować przesuwając.
Znacznie praktyczniej i intuicyjniej było, gdyby skalowanie odbywało się tak jak w programach graficznych, względem geometrycznego środka figury. Albo żeby był jakiś wybór jak to ma przebiegać, bo operacja jest "delikatna". To samo dotyczy pozostałych operacji przekształcenia. Nie ma większego problemu, gdy konwertujemy całość. Ale gdy modyfikacji ulega fragment pracy, to wzajemne położenie elementów rysunku jest kluczowe i powinno dać się kontrolować.
Prosto i dobrze jest to zrobione w Corelu. Przez domniemanie środek figury jest środkiem geometrycznym dla przekształceń. I wszystkie przekształcenia sa związane ze środkiem figury. Ale środek można przesuwać i wtedy wszystkie przekształcenia, nadal trzymając się tego "środka geometrii", wychodzą już inaczej.
Dlatego fajnie by było, gdyby każdej figurze byłby przyporządkowany taki środek geometrii: przez domniemanie umieszczony centralnie, ale możliwy do przestawienia. Nie płynnie, ale "technicznie", czyli 4 rogi, 4 środki boków i środek geometryczny. To nawet nie musiałoby byc zapamiętywane dla uproszczenia. Po co, skoro ctrl-z działa tylko o jeden krok. Wystarczyłoby, żeby dało się to wybrać na etapie każdorazowego wejścia w przekształcenie jakiejkolwiek figury.
2.2.2
Nie wiem czy to błąd czy raczej celowe. Miałem taką potrzebę, żeby jeden z elementów rysunku (okrąg) delikatnie przeskalować bez modyfikacji źródła rysunku (bo już miałem wszystkie elementy w camie pracowicie przygotowane). Element był w wydzielonej grupie wraz z innym koncentrycznym do niego okręgiem. Po przeskalowaniu środek figury uległ przesunięciu, bo zdaje się że lewy dolny róg figury jest traktowany jako środek układu współrzędnych. No i potem musiałem to "na oko" ręcznie centrować przesuwając.
Znacznie praktyczniej i intuicyjniej było, gdyby skalowanie odbywało się tak jak w programach graficznych, względem geometrycznego środka figury. Albo żeby był jakiś wybór jak to ma przebiegać, bo operacja jest "delikatna". To samo dotyczy pozostałych operacji przekształcenia. Nie ma większego problemu, gdy konwertujemy całość. Ale gdy modyfikacji ulega fragment pracy, to wzajemne położenie elementów rysunku jest kluczowe i powinno dać się kontrolować.
Prosto i dobrze jest to zrobione w Corelu. Przez domniemanie środek figury jest środkiem geometrycznym dla przekształceń. I wszystkie przekształcenia sa związane ze środkiem figury. Ale środek można przesuwać i wtedy wszystkie przekształcenia, nadal trzymając się tego "środka geometrii", wychodzą już inaczej.
Dlatego fajnie by było, gdyby każdej figurze byłby przyporządkowany taki środek geometrii: przez domniemanie umieszczony centralnie, ale możliwy do przestawienia. Nie płynnie, ale "technicznie", czyli 4 rogi, 4 środki boków i środek geometryczny. To nawet nie musiałoby byc zapamiętywane dla uproszczenia. Po co, skoro ctrl-z działa tylko o jeden krok. Wystarczyłoby, żeby dało się to wybrać na etapie każdorazowego wejścia w przekształcenie jakiejkolwiek figury.
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 8
- Posty: 1714
- Rejestracja: 13 sty 2006, 16:41
- Lokalizacja: Stargard
- Kontakt:
Ostatnio cały czas pracuję na magazynie narzędzi i jedną rzecz by się przydało zmienić.
Mianowicie jeśli mam ustawiony magazyn narzędzi w piko i robię na jego podstawie w pikocamie ścieżkę to warto by było by program do pliku *.cam zapisał informację o magazynie narzędzi jaki miał w tym momencie ustawiony.
Bo jeśli następny projekt robię z zadeklarowanym innym magazynem narzędzi to do poprzedniego wracać trzeba po omacku.
Fajnie jak by program po otworzeniu pliku *.cam zapytał się czy przywrócić magazyn narzędzi aktualny dla tego pliku... Wtedy łatwo sobie można na maszynie ustawić magazyn odpowiedni dla ścieżki z tego pliku cam.
Mianowicie jeśli mam ustawiony magazyn narzędzi w piko i robię na jego podstawie w pikocamie ścieżkę to warto by było by program do pliku *.cam zapisał informację o magazynie narzędzi jaki miał w tym momencie ustawiony.
Bo jeśli następny projekt robię z zadeklarowanym innym magazynem narzędzi to do poprzedniego wracać trzeba po omacku.
Fajnie jak by program po otworzeniu pliku *.cam zapytał się czy przywrócić magazyn narzędzi aktualny dla tego pliku... Wtedy łatwo sobie można na maszynie ustawić magazyn odpowiedni dla ścieżki z tego pliku cam.
https://www.instagram.com/cncworkshop.pl/
Obróbka CNC - frezowanie & toczenie
Obróbka CNC - frezowanie & toczenie
-
- ELITA FORUM (min. 1000)
- Posty w temacie: 148
- Posty: 1618
- Rejestracja: 17 paź 2004, 20:49
- Lokalizacja: Swarzędz
- Kontakt:
Chyba kiedyś sam o to prosiłeś.mc2kwacz pisze:Kto wie do czego służy szablon ze zrzutu ekranowego 2 posty wcześniej i czym to się je?

Najpierw zaznaczasz interesujące Ciebie parametry, potem je zapisujesz. Jak potrzeba z tymi samymi parametrami coś zrobić, to nie trzeba wszystkie wpisywać, tylko otworzyć szablon.
Robert
-
Autor tematu - Lider FORUM (min. 2000)
- Posty w temacie: 63
- Posty: 2920
- Rejestracja: 27 maja 2013, 22:18
- Lokalizacja: gdzieś
To prawda, że prosiłem. Tyle że nie udało mi się tego użyć. Nazwa szablonu pojawiła się w okienku, ale nastawy pozostały bez zmian. Żadnych nie zaznaczałem, założyłem że zapisze się komplet. Może to był ten błąd.
A jako że nie miałem czasu się z tym "bujać", więc użyłem, metody znanej i działającej, czyli "zapisz parametry jako domyślne". Choć efektywne wykorzystanie tego jest kłopotliwe przy większych projektach.
Spróbuję jeszcze raz z zaznaczaniem w najbliższej przyszłości.
A jako że nie miałem czasu się z tym "bujać", więc użyłem, metody znanej i działającej, czyli "zapisz parametry jako domyślne". Choć efektywne wykorzystanie tego jest kłopotliwe przy większych projektach.
Spróbuję jeszcze raz z zaznaczaniem w najbliższej przyszłości.